What Is the Lock and Key Design Pattern?

What is a lock key puzzle?.

The Lock and Key Design Pattern takes it's name from literal lock and key puzzles in many computer games.

Take Doom for example, each level has a start and exit but usually you can't travel directly between them. The direct path is blocked by locked doors, to open ...

